为了丰富压杆的稳定性研究内容和方便工程应用之目的,用初参数法,对中部任意位置增加一个定向支承加固的七种压杆,建立了统一的变形方程和静力平衡方程。由各自的变形和静力约束条件,导出了求解临界压力的特征方程。借助软件,求得了压杆的长度因数与中部支承位置间的近似或精确关系;同时确定了中部支承的最佳位置和最小长度因数,以及最差位置和最大长度因数。经验证,结果符合理论预期。For enriching the research content about the stability of a long column and making it convenient in the engineering application, by using the initial parameters method, seven kinds of long column are strengthened by directional support in any position of central, and the unified deformation equa-tions and static force equilibrium equations are established. By the respective constraint conditions of deformation and static force, the characteristic equations of critical force are solved. By software, the approximate or accurate relationship between the factor of length of long column and the posi-tion of the central directional support are determined; at the same time, the best position of the central directional support and the minimum factor of length, and the worst position and the maximum factor of length are all determined. The result is verified according with theoretical expectation.
